FRA’s Forensic Technology practice is a global data and technology team focused on supporting clients dealing with complex regulatory and compliance issues, investigations, and disputes. Our team manages the entire analytics life cycle from data discovery through analysis and reporting ensuring that our clients get the information and insights they need.

As a Data Analytics Associate in our Forensic Technology practice, you will support our project teams in the delivery of wide-ranging and insightful analytical analyses while reporting to various internal and external stakeholders including some of the world’s largest companies and regulatory agencies. You will have the opportunity to work with large multifaceted datasets across multiple industries such as Aerospace and Defence, Manufacturing, and Finance.

Day to Day Responsibilities

  • Be involved in all aspects of the end-to-end data life cycle for an engagement: data collection, data extraction, transform, and loading (ETL), analysis, visualizations, and client delivery/reporting.
  • Execute analytics on large datasets using a wide range of technologies and techniques including SQL, Python, Power BI, Machine Learning, and Network Analytics.
  • Develop algorithms and solutions to identify and investigate instances of fraud, bribery and corruption, misconduct, and financial crime.
  • Synthesize new insights by relating data from disparate data sources/databases such as business reporting systems, en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, and other semi-structured data sources.
  • Collaborate with fraud investigators, internal/external auditors, lawyers, and regulatory agencies to provide solutions to our clients’ unique challenges and prepare effective and intuitive analytic results that support engagement objectives.
  • Contribute to Forensic Technology strategic initiatives including the usage of new technology and techniques, enhanced processes and procedures, and thought leadership.
  • Evolve and progress technical capabilities through work experience, training programs, external networking, and relevant certifications.
